Country music singer Julie Roberts is no stranger to overcoming hard times through determination, hard work, and strength. Having escaped the emotional residue of her alcoholic fathers actions and insults, Julie moved from South Carolina to Nashville, Tennessee, to attend Belmont University and work as a receptionist at Mercury Recordsall while secretly pursuing her dream of becoming a singer. Filling her nights with music and booking shows at obscure venues, the one requirement when Julie was hired at Universal Music Group was that she not be an aspiring singer. Yet, despite her best efforts to keep quiet, Julie knew God had placed music within her as a child and that it was bound to come out sooner or later. Raw, honest, and sometimes painful, Julies lyrics resonated quickly with country music fans, and her emotionsoaked debut albuma reflection of her own painful pastwas an instant success.Just as Julies dreams were coming true, her life began to unravel. Soon, she was battling debilitating physical illness, the rising waters of Nashvilles hundredyear flood, and a stalled career. Instead of succumbing to despair, Julie proved miraculously resilienttaking the steps she needed to face adversity head on and rebuild her life through her characteristic optimism, hard work, and faith.
